N5193A UXG Agile Signal Generator 10 MHz to 20 or 40 GHz

●Definitions and Conditions:
■Specification (spec): represents warranted performance of a calibrated instrument that has been stored for a minimum of 2 hours within the operating temperature range of 0 to 55 °C, unless otherwise stated, and after a 1 hour warm-up period. The specifications include measurement uncertainty. Data represented in this document are specifications unless otherwise noted.
■Typical (typ): describes additional product performance information. It is performance beyond specifications that 80% of the units exhibit with a 95% confidence level at room temperature (approximately 25 °C). Typical performance does not include measurement uncertainty.
■Nominal (nom): describes the expected mean or average performance, or an attribute whose performance is by design, such as the 50 Ω connector. This data is not warranted and is measured at room temperature (approximately 25 °C).
■Measured (meas): describes an attribute measured during the design phase for purposes of communicating expected performance, such as amplitude drift vs. time. This data is not warranted and is measured at room temperature (approximately 25 °C).
■All of the above apply when using the instrument in its default settings unless otherwise stated.
■This data sheet provides a summary of the key performance parameters for the N5193A UXG Agile Signal Generator. All options referenced in this data sheet are described in the UXG configuration guide (5992-1116EN).
■Unless otherwise noted, this data sheet applies to units with serial numbers ending with 5646xxxx or greater and firmware revision A.01.86.
